How much do security program manager j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 6, 2026, the average yearly pay for security program manager in Lees Summit, MO is $144,988.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$125,500.00 and $152,800.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a security program manager?

A Security Program Manager (SPM) oversees an organization's security initiatives, ensuring they align with business objectives and compliance requirements. They coordinate security programs, manage risks, and implement policies to protect assets, data, and infrastructure. SPMs work closely with cross-functional teams, including IT, legal, and leadership, to enhance security posture. Their role involves assessing threats, driving security awareness, and managing security projects efficiently.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a security program manager?

To thrive as a Security Program Manager, you need a solid background in information security, risk management, and project management, typically bolstered by a relevant degree and experience in security operations. Experience with security frameworks (like NIST or ISO 27001), tools such as SIEM platforms, and certifications like CISSP or PMP are highly valued. Excellent cross-functional communication, leadership, and problem-solving abilities help you coordinate teams and drive initiatives forward. These capabilities are crucial to effectively lead security programs, mitigate risks, and ensure organizational compliance in a dynamic threat landscape.

What are some typical challenges faced by security program managers, and how are they addressed?

Security Program Managers often face challenges such as balancing evolving cybersecurity threats with business objectives, managing cross-departmental initiatives, and ensuring ongoing compliance with industry standards. Success in this role typically involves continuous learning to stay ahead of threat trends, fostering collaboration among IT, compliance, and executive stakeholders, and implementing clear processes for incident response and policy enforcement. Program Managers regularly review and adjust security strategies, conduct gap analyses, and ensure team alignment through effective communication and stakeholder engagement. Proactively addressing these challenges helps maintain robust security postures while enabling organizations to achieve their goals.

Job description

The Technical Program Manager is responsible for driving the delivery of high-impact technical programs in alignment with both business and technical objectives. The scope of this job includes working closely with engineering, solution management, design, and operations teams to plan, prioritize, and execute key initiatives while navigating the technical challenges and risks associated with large-scale projects.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Own and drive the end-to-end delivery of individual, moderately complex technical programs and projects, including scoping, planning, execution, and final delivery.
  • Partner with engineering teams, solution managers, designers, quality assurance, and other stakeholders to ensure clear communication, alignment on objectives, and smooth execution of program deliverables.
  • Develop and maintain detailed technical project plans, including roadmaps, timelines, milestones, dependencies, deadlines, and deliverables.
  • Proactively identify potential risks and technical blockers that may impact program timelines or quality, and work with relevant teams to resolve issues and keep the program on course.
  • Communicate program status, challenges, and progress to leadership by providing regular updates and actionable insights in alignment with business priorities.
  • LeverageAItools and platforms as an integral part of daily responsibilities to enhance decision-making, streamline workflows, and drive data-informed outcomes.
  • Develop and articulate program goals, objectives, and milestones aligned with organizational strategies and technical direction.
  • Foster strong relationships with key stakeholders to promote support and cooperation throughout the program lifecycle, clearly communicate requirements, and manage expectations.
  • Identify opportunities for process improvement and efficiency within the program.
  • Perform other job duties as assigned.

Required Qualifications:

  • Bachelor's Degree in a related field or equivalent work experience
  • At least 2-4 years relevant work experience
  • Familiarity with AI-powered tools and technologies, or a demonstrated openness to learning and incorporating AI solutions to improve productivity, decision-making, and program delivery

Preferred Qualifications:

  • Experience working in the healthcare industry or supporting healthcare technology initiatives
  • Experience using the Atlassian Suite (including Jira and Confluence) and GitHub to support project tracking, collaboration, and technical program delivery

Job Expectations:

  • Willing to work additional or irregular hours as needed
  • Must work in accordance with applicable security policies and procedures to safeguard company and client information
  • Must be able to sit and view a computer screen for extended periods of time
